Small yacht mooring buoys are equipped with soft components. It is recommended for bow and stern mooring systems and single buoy mooring systems.
Most mooring buoys are generally attached to a ground chain which is attached to a heavy object or anchor buried in the sea bed.
Often the buoy itself is too heavy to lift as it has to be big enough to support the heavy riser chain, so there is normally a ring on top of the buoy to moor to, and even sometimes a "pick up" line which makes life even easier.
Construction:
● Thermolaminated resilient polyethylene foam core
● Self-colour spray applied polyurethane elastomer skin
● Available with or without a shackle recess
● Slot or hole option
● Galvanized steel wear protection plate
● Available in orange or yellow color as standard
Characteristics
► Durable and long lasting materials
► Virtually non-marking skin
► Wear and abrasion resistant outer skin
► Won't sink even if it's broken
► High impact absorption energy
► Low maintenance
► Easy handling for simple and safe operation
